MAX17605ASA+ information
ADI MAX17605ASA+ technical specifications, attributes, parameters and parts with similar specifications to ADI MAX17605ASA+.
- Type
- Parameter
- Factory Lead Time
- 6 Weeks
- Mount
- Surface Mount
- Mounting Type
- Surface Mount
- Package / Case
- 8-SOIC (0.154, 3.90mm Width)
- Number of Pins
- 8
- Operating Temperature
- -40°C~150°C TJ
- Packaging
- Tube
- Published
- 2012
- Pbfree Code
- yes
- Part Status
- Active
- Moisture Sensitivity Level (MSL)
- 1 (Unlimited)
- Number of Terminations
- 8
- ECCN Code
- EAR99
- Max Power Dissipation
- 588.2mW
- Technology
- BICMOS
- Voltage - Supply
- 4V~14V
- Terminal Form
- GULL WING
- Number of Functions
- 2
- Supply Voltage
- 12V
- Base Part Number
- MAX17605
- Pin Count
- 8
- Max Output Current
- 4A
- Element Configuration
- Dual
- Nominal Supply Current
- 1A
- Input Type
- Inverting, Non-Inverting
- Turn On Delay Time
- 12 ns
- Rise Time
- 6ns
- Fall Time (Typ)
- 5 ns
- Turn-Off Delay Time
- 12 ns
- Rise / Fall Time (Typ)
- 40ns 25ns
- Interface IC Type
- HALF BRIDGE BASED MOSFET DRIVER
- Channel Type
- Independent
- Number of Drivers
- 2
- Output Peak Current Limit-Nom
- 4A
- Driven Configuration
- Low-Side
- Gate Type
- IGBT, SiC MOSFET
- Current - Peak Output (Source, Sink)
- 4A 4A
- High Side Driver
- YES
- Logic Voltage - VIL, VIH
- 2V 4.25V
- Length
- 4.9mm
- Height Seated (Max)
- 1.75mm
- Width
- 3.9mm
- Radiation Hardening
- No
- RoHS Status
- RoHS Compliant
